London-area home sales opened 2026 on a subdued note, with January transactions dropping to their lowest level for the month in three years. Realtor data released Tuesday by the London and St. Thomas Association of Realtors shows 341 residential properties were sold during the month, representing a 10.3 per cent decline from January 2025.
While fewer homes changed hands, prices continued to edge higher. The average resale price rose by approximately $10,000 in January to $624,550. Middlesex Centre posted the highest average sale price at $861,600, while Strathroy-Caradoc was third at $720,806. The Forest City recorded the lowest average home price among local markets.
